Lu Ann Meredith (July 7, 1913—November 12, 1998) was an American film actress. Picked as one of the WAMPAS Baby Stars in 1934,[1] her career did not flourish unlike a number of other awardees such as Jean Arthur and Ginger Rogers.[2] In 1935, she had a romance with David Lean,[3] who discussed marriage with her mother Cheerio Meredith. She made a few appearances in British films, but by 1937 her film career had declined. She appeared in a total of nine films between 1934 and 1939 before retiring from acting.
